The Elder Scrolls IV: Oblivion Remastered is an action role-playing game co-developed by Virtuos and Bethesda Game Studios, and published by Bethesda Softworks. It is a remaster of the 2006 game The Elder Scrolls IV: Oblivion. It was simultaneously announced and released for Windows, PlayStation 5, and Xbox Series X/S on April 22, 2025.[1]
Gameplay
The game retains the open-world structure and core gameplay mechanics of the original, including real-time combat, character leveling, skill-based progression, and questlines tied to multiple factions.[2] The remaster includes a full graphical overhaul with modern rendering techniques, ray tracing, and updated textures and models. Non-playable character behavior has been revised using improved AI, and all animations have been updated. The user interface and control schemes have also been redesigned for compatibility with current-generation hardware. Audio enhancements include re-recorded ambient sounds, environmental effects, and limited redone voice work.[3][4]
Knights of the Nine and Shivering Isles, which are paid expansion packs of the original game, are also included in the Remastered edition.[5]

The game is set in the province of Cyrodiil, the player takes the role of the Hero of Kvatch, who is drawn into a conflict involving the Daedric realm of Oblivion after the assassination of Emperor Uriel Septim VII.[6]
Development
The game was co-developed by Virtuos' Paris studio and Bethesda Game Studios. Both studios began development of the remaster in 2021. The developers used Unreal Engine 5 to enhance the visuals, while relying on the Creation Engine for core elements like physics and combat.[7]
Initial indications of the remaster emerged in September 2023, when internal Microsoft documents disclosed during the Federal Trade Commission v. Microsoft case referenced an "Oblivion Remaster" slated for release in the 2022 fiscal year.[8] Further speculation arose in April 2025, following the discovery of in-game images and promotional materials on Virtuos' website, which were subsequently shared online. On April 21, 2025, Bethesda confirmed the remaster's existence by announcing a livestream scheduled for the following day.[9]
